Product reviews:
Mortimer
2025-07-08 iphone 11 Pro Max
24 Scale Die Cast Replica diecast delorean time machine
diecast delorean time machine
Simon
2025-07-04 iphone 7 Plus
DeLorean Time Machine Diecast Model Car diecast delorean time machine
diecast delorean time machine
Montague
2025-07-08 iphone 11
24 SCALE DIECAST CAR BY WELLY 22443SV diecast delorean time machine
diecast delorean time machine
Welly 1/24 Delorean Time Machine (Back diecast delorean time machine
diecast delorean time machine